    Jags fans upset by blowout loss to Bills

    US PRESSWIRE

    The final score of an NFL game can sometimes be misleading, and when the Jacksonville Jaguars eventually ended up losing to the Buffalo Bills, 34-18, that turned out to be true. But, much to the chagrin of the Jaguars’ faithful, the blowout loss looked better on paper than it actually was in person.

    That’s at least how the guys over at Big Cat Country felt after seeing the Jaguars drop another game, this time to a Bills team that shut down an offense that had started to click these last few weeks.

    Cecil Shorts catches TD in 4th straight game

    US PRESSWIRE

    Fantasy Impact: Shorts has moved into solid WR2 territory. He could have put up better yardage against the Bills, but the weather was ugly and he has gone over 100 yards in three of his last six outings. Henne has been locked into the wideout since taking over the starting quarterback job.

    Scott Chandler catches TD in win over Jaguars

    Rick Stewart

    Chandler now has 32 receptions for 417 yards and six touchdowns on the year. He has found the end zone twice in his last four games played.

    Fantasy Impact: Chandler owners lucked out. What should have been a dud turned into a serviceable performance with the score. He has found the end zone in five of the 12 games he has played this season, so the odds were not in his favor.

    Stevie Johson saves fantasy outing with touchdown

    Bob Levey

    Fantasy Impact: Johnson hasn’t been bad by any means this season, but after back-to-back big seasons, fantasy owners are justifiably disappointed. Thank goodness he found the end zone Sunday, or owners would have had to deal with a major hole in their lineup, just in time for the playoffs.

    Johnson is going to be a risky starting fantasy option going forward. The Bills will be playing three of their final four games at home, and will have to contend with potentially nasty weather at Ralph Wilson Stadium.

    C.J. Spiller overshadowed by Fred Jackson

    US PRESSWIRE

    Fantasy Impact: Gailey heeded the cries of fantasy owners everywhere last week, before doing an about face this week against the Jags. Jackson has been solid this season and throughout his career, granted, but few players in the league have been as explosive as Spiller. It’s curious that the coaching staff refuses to give Spiller a feature role, but yet here we are.

    That said, Spiller was still plenty productive Sunday. Assuming the two backs continue their timeshare, their fantasy value is capped at RB2 status going forward.

    Fitzpatrick scores 3 TDs in win over Jaguars

    Rick Stewart

    Fitzpatrick’s rushing score was his first of the season and fourth of his career. He now has 21 total touchdowns on the season.

    Fantasy Impact: Fitzpatrick’s rushing touchdown was a nice bonus for fantasy owners, especially considering he doesn’t have a history of getting goal-line carries in his seven-year career. He was pretty lucky to find the end zone passing too, considering the effective running game and the sloppy weather.

    Bills defense strong as they dominate Jaguars

    Tom Szczerbowski

    The Jaguars offense has been suddenly potent over the last two weeks, nearly knocking off Houston two weeks ago and besting Tennessee last week. The Bills defense, however, plugged the Jags’ run game, holding them to only fifty yards, and kept Henne to only 236 yards passing.

    Fantasy Studs: The Bills’ runners. Spiller had a frustrating day for three quarters, but snapped off a 44-yard touchdown run that redeemed his fantasy value, and Jackson ran for 109 yards. Shorts had seven catches for 77 yards and a touchdown before he had to leave the game with a head injury.

    Rashad Jennings out for the game against the Bills

    Jim Rogash

    Jennings was off to an uneventful start to the game for the Jaguars before injuring his head. He is out for the game, according to Ryan O’Hallaran. Jenning had eight rushes for 20 yards before the injury. He had just ripped off a 12 yard gain on the play that knocked him out of the game.

    The Buffalo Bills usually struggle to defend the run, but the Jaguars have had issues with run blocking so far in this game. Perhaps Owens can provide a spark for the run game.
